James Edward Walker, age 65, of Vancleave, passed away on October 7, 2016.
He was preceded in death by his parents, Jerry ""Pete"" Walker, Sr. and Eva C. Walker, and a brother, Jerry E. Walker, Jr., and his beloved pet ""Sassy.""
Survivors include his loving wife of 39 years, Theresa ""Terrie"" Walker, a daughter, Michelle Walker (Brian) Oliver, 2 sisters, Brenda Walker Pleasant, and his twin, Janice M. Walker, his best friend, Buddy Cospelich, and numerous nieces, nephews, and other relatives.
Mr. Walker served in the U.S. Navy during the Vietnam War and worked for the City of Gulfport over 20 years, owned and operated a catering business with his wife, and later retired from AT&T in the fraudulent card usage division.
He was a faithful member of Ramsay Hills Baptist Church where he enjoyed singing. He will be greatly missed by his family and friends.
